Brief Summary

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.

This is an open, uncontrolled pilot study of thirty chronic HCV infected patients carried out at Yassin Abdel Ghaffar Charity Center for Liver Disease and Research. The aim of this study is to investigate the safety \& efficacy of combined therapy sofosbuvir (SOF) and daclatasvir (DCV) for treating HCV Genotype 4 in children aged 8 to 18. Due to previous positive results in other clinical studies of this drug it is expected that the drug will have high safety and high efficacy. Safety will be measured by checking for adverse effects, while efficacy will be measured by Real-Time Quantitative Polymerase Chain Reaction (qPCR) detecting viral nucleic acids in blood samples.

Study Groups

Review each arm or cohort in the study, along with the interventions and objectives associated with them.

Combined Therapy SOF and DCV

Group Type EXPERIMENTAL

Combined Therapy SOF and DCV

Intervention Type DRUG

1 whole or half tablet sofosbuvir and 1 whole or half tablet daclatasvir per day

SOF dosage: 400 mg/day for greater than 45 kg weight patients; 200 mg/day for 17 kg to 45 kg patients

DCV dosage: 60 mg/day for greater than 45 kg weight patients; 30 mg for 17 kg to 45 kg patients

Eligibility Criteria

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.

Inclusion Criteria

1. Age: 8-18 years
2. Sex: both sexes
3. Naïve patients, with chronic HCV infection

Exclusion Criteria

1. Co-infection with Hepatitis B virus (HBV)
2. Other associated chronic liver illness
3. Cirrhotic patients (as indicated by biopsy, fibroscan(F4)
4. Patients with history of hematemesis (non cirrhotic portal hypertension)
5. Patients on drugs known to interact unfavorably with SOF (Amiodarone,..)
